## Runbook: Gaugepile Sidecar — Release Checklist

Heads up: the sidecar ships with every app pod, so a bad config fans out fast. Before cutting a release, confirm the flush interval hasn't drifted from what the Tallyhouse aggregator expects, or you'll see sawtooth gaps in dashboards. Rollbacks are cheap — just repin the image tag. Canary one node pool first, watch for ten minutes, then proceed. The values to verify against are these.

config for bagep-yafof:
quenath:
  pin: 8584
  metrics_host: metrics.quenath.tolvaqsys.internal
  tenant: pelath
  seal: seal_ed102645

Welcome to the Flagwright team. Flagwright is Norvane's feature-flag rollout framework. All flags live in the central registry; never hardcode toggles. Rollouts proceed in stages: internal, canary (5%), then general. Each stage requires sign-off from the flag owner. Kill switches must be tested before any canary push. Stale flags older than 90 days get flagged for removal automatically. Read the contributing guide before opening your first change. The full rollout policy and stage checklist live on the internal wiki page here:

wiki page, fahaf-yagag: https://confluence.qorvellabs.internal/pages/display/pages/display

**Vendor note: Inkmill markdown pipeline**

Rendering for Parchway docs is outsourced to Inkmill under an annual contract, renewing each March. They handle sanitization and PDF export; we own the upload queue. SLA: 4-hour response on rendering failures. Escalate only after two failed retries. Their support desk is reachable at the address below.

billing contact of hahaf-baguf = zorael.tammir.jorius@sivrelhq.internal

### TileForge Cache Layer — Auth

Quick note for release: the TileForge cache layer sits between the renderer and the map store, so warm-up calls must authenticate before tiles get pinned. Hit `/cache/warm` with a POST once the deploy settles — it's idempotent, so reruns are fine. Requests without auth get a 401 and an empty cache, which is painful. Use the staging key below.

app token of bahaf-tajeg = zpat23_SjjsllwiLmXbtS65veZaV47